U.S. Air Force Tech. Sgt. Troy McCary, 724th Air Mobility Squadron standardization and evaluation program manager, works on a new competency-based framework focused on developmental levels in order to properly assess an Airman’s job ability at Joint Base Charleston, South Carolina, June 10, 2026.The workshop helped air transportation subject matter experts translate existing training records into the new competency-based framework to assist Airmen in upgrade training.
